Hey guys, I want to put a full z suspension on my 2005 g35x but I heard that some parts don't fit. I searched for quite sometimes but couldn't find a clear answer. Is putting a full z suspension on an 05 g35x sedan possible? Thanks

This is correct. Front springs, rear springs and rear shocks are interchangeable. Also, remember that any springs you put on will lower you ~.5" more than it would on a RWD.Originally Posted by 01yellowr
